Facts about
- The name 'Miracle' because of the magical experience you get after eating it.
- When you have lemon after eating this fruit, it tastes sweet as if it is added with sugar.
- It is also used as natural sweetener.
- In Italy, it's a belief that diet rich in eggplant leads to madness. Hence, they call it a 'crazy apple'.
- Eggplant contains nicotine & can help quit smoking.
- Juice made from its leaves and roots is medicinal.

The order of Miracle fruit and Eggplant is Ericales and Solanales respectively. Miracle fruit belongs to Sapotaceae family and Eggplant belongs to Solanaceae family. Miracle fruit belongs to Synsepalum genus of S. dulcificum species and Eggplant belongs to Solanum genus of S. melongena species. Beings plants, both fruits belong to Plantae Kingdom.
